Transaction ae23b8e15f4e1280c4b5ec312929cef7ef72a417d8f8095fb62f2bf9e62e73d4
3 Input
2 Outputs
- ae23b8e15f4e1280c4b5ec312929cef7ef72a417d8f8095fb62f2bf9e62e73d4:0
- ae23b8e15f4e1280c4b5ec312929cef7ef72a417d8f8095fb62f2bf9e62e73d4:1
value 1101768
address 1DLfVQg3fSXAJRPg4zubzMYd8XyjZC9Mij
value 3481500
address 1DRWksH4pmuDD1BgtHADfGa89ZTJS8nQGW